Compulsory internment, also known as involuntary commitment, is a legal process that allows for the temporary detention of individuals with severe substance abuse problems. While some may argue that this infringes upon personal freedoms, it is important to recognize that addiction is a disease that often robs individuals of their ability to make rational decisions and take care of themselves. In these cases, compulsory internment can be a lifeline, providing the necessary structure and support for individuals to recover.
